What Are Mechanical Disc Brakes and How Do They Work?
Mechanical disc brakes are a type of braking system commonly used in bicycles, offering reliable stopping power and ease of maintenance.
- Components: Mechanical disc brakes consist of several key components including the brake lever, cables, caliper, and rotor. The brake lever is pulled by the rider, which pulls the cable that moves the caliper, causing the brake pads to clamp down onto the rotor.
- How They Work: When the rider squeezes the brake lever, tension is applied to the brake cable. This activates the caliper, which pushes the brake pads against the spinning rotor, creating friction that slows down or stops the wheel.
- Advantages: Mechanical disc brakes are known for their simplicity and ease of adjustment. They perform well in various weather conditions and provide consistent stopping power, making them a popular choice for both casual and serious cyclists.
- Maintenance: Regular maintenance involves checking the brake pads for wear and adjusting the cable tension as needed. Unlike hydraulic systems, mechanical disc brakes can be serviced with basic tools and do not require specialized knowledge.

What Factors Should You Consider When Choosing the Best Mechanical Disc Brakes?
When choosing the best mechanical disc brakes for a bicycle, several key factors should be considered to ensure optimal performance and compatibility.
- Brake Compatibility: Ensure that the mechanical disc brakes you select are compatible with your bike’s frame and fork mountings. Different bikes may have varying standards for rotor sizes and caliper mounts, so checking compatibility is essential to avoid installation issues.
- Rotor Size: The size of the rotor can significantly affect braking performance. Larger rotors provide more stopping power and better heat dissipation, which is beneficial for downhill riding or heavy loads, while smaller rotors may be lighter and sufficient for casual riding.
- Brake Lever Feel: The feel of the brake lever is crucial for rider confidence and control. Test different lever types to find one that provides a comfortable grip and requires the right amount of force for effective braking.
- Adjustability: Look for brakes that offer adjustability features, such as pad alignment and lever reach adjustments. This allows for customization based on personal preference and can improve braking efficiency and comfort during rides.
- Weight: The weight of the mechanical disc brakes can affect the overall performance and handling of the bike. Lighter brakes contribute to better acceleration and climbing but may sacrifice some durability, so consider the balance between weight and performance needs.
- Durability and Maintenance: Select brakes known for their durability and ease of maintenance. Mechanical disc brakes require occasional adjustment and maintenance, so choosing a design that allows for straightforward maintenance can save time and effort in the long run.

What Maintenance Tips Can Help Extend the Life of Mechanical Disc Brakes?
To ensure the longevity and optimal performance of mechanical disc brakes on bicycles, several maintenance tips are essential.
- Regular Cleaning: Keeping the brake components clean from dirt and debris is crucial. Dirt can cause premature wear on the brake pads and rotors, leading to decreased performance and potential safety issues.
- Inspect Brake Pads: Regularly check the brake pads for wear and tear. Worn pads should be replaced promptly to maintain effective braking power and prevent damage to the rotor.
- Adjust Cable Tension: Proper cable tension is vital for responsive braking. Regularly check and adjust the tension to ensure the brakes engage fully without excessive force.
- Check Rotor Alignment: Ensure that the rotor is properly aligned with the brake calipers. Misalignment can lead to uneven wear and a decrease in braking efficiency, so adjustments may be necessary to keep everything in line.
- Lubricate Moving Parts: Use appropriate lubricants on pivot points and cable housing to reduce friction and ensure smooth operation. However, avoid getting lubricant on the brake pads or rotors, as this can compromise braking performance.
- Monitor Brake Performance: Pay attention to how your brakes feel during rides. If you notice any unusual sounds, reduced responsiveness, or vibrations, investigate immediately to identify and address potential issues.
What Innovations and Features Should You Look for in Mechanical Disc Brakes?
When searching for the best mechanical disc brakes for bicycles, consider the following innovations and features:
- Adjustable Reach: Adjustable reach allows cyclists to customize the lever distance to fit their hand size and preferences, enhancing comfort and control during braking.
- Self-Adjusting Mechanism: Some mechanical disc brakes include a self-adjusting feature that maintains optimal pad-to-disc clearance, ensuring consistent braking performance without frequent manual adjustments.
- Heat Dissipation Technology: Advanced designs incorporate heat sinks or ventilation in the brake rotors to dissipate heat more effectively, preventing brake fade during prolonged use or steep descents.
- Lightweight Materials: The use of lightweight yet durable materials, such as aluminum or carbon fiber, helps reduce overall bike weight while maintaining structural integrity and performance.
- Tool-Free Pad Replacement: Tool-free systems for replacing brake pads simplify maintenance, allowing riders to easily swap out worn pads without needing specialized tools, which is convenient for on-the-road adjustments.
- Integrated Cable Routing: Innovative cable routing systems help keep cables protected from damage and dirt, improving performance and longevity while providing a cleaner aesthetic on the bicycle.
- Compatibility with Various Rotor Sizes: The best mechanical disc brakes offer compatibility with multiple rotor sizes, allowing riders to choose the ideal setup for their riding style and conditions, whether for street riding or mountain biking.
